Action item from the Lanefill autocomplete incident: the widget returned stale suggestions for roughly four hours after the Tilmore geocache refresh failed silently. Support should advise affected customers to clear the form cache and retry; no data was lost. Engineering has added a freshness check that pages the Geo team directly. Step-by-step customer guidance, canned responses, and the escalation path are documented on the internal page below.

operations page: https://jenkins.zemvarcloud.local/job/merge_requests/repo/build/73930b4b30f0a8ed

Subject: Flaky integration tests on Ledgerbeam payments

Team, the Ledgerbeam integration suite failed twice on main this morning and passed on retry both times. The flakes are concentrated in the settlement webhook tests, likely a race between the mock clearinghouse and the retry worker. I've quarantined the three worst offenders and opened a follow-up to add deterministic clocks. Reviews on the quarantine PR are welcome before the afternoon cut. The failing run can be inspected using the trace token below.

pipeline stamp: htk3_69f

CI note: Rounding drift in Pennywhistle currency tests

If the conversion suite fails on half-cent cases, the cause is usually banker's rounding mismatching the fixture expectations. Regenerate fixtures with the round-half-even flag before rerunning. Attach results to the ticket along with the failing build's identifier, which appears below.

pipeline stamp: htk14_378fd70323001d

## Deployment: Deep-Link Routing

Welcome aboard. The Mistralbay mobile app routes deep links through the Pathwright gateway, which maps inbound URIs to in-app screens. Each environment carries its own routing manifest, so a link that works in staging may dead-end in production if the manifests drift. Always deploy the gateway before the app binaries, and verify the route table version in the healthcheck response. Smoke-test at least three link patterns after each rollout. The gateway reads its runtime configuration from the following values.

service settings:
[casax]
port = 6379
team = rusir
host = casax.zemvarhq.corp
region = outer-4
access_code = ac_9808ce
timeout_ms = 1500